Step by step recipe


Stage 1 - ⌛ 30 min.
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 1
Prepare 500 g broad beans, then set aside.

Stage 2 - ⌛ 5 min.
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 2
Cut 150 g belly (streaky) bacon into small pieces.

Stage 3 - ⌛ 5 min.
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 3
In a small frying pan over medium heat, pour in the fat-free lardons and toast, stirring occasionally.

Stage 4 - ⌛ 3 min.
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 4
Meanwhile, prepare and slice 1 shallot.

Stage 5 - ⌛ 2 min.
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 5
When the lardons are toasted to your liking, add the minced shallot and 4 leaves sage, season with salt and pepper, then cook for another minute or 2, stirring constantly.

Stage 6 - ⌛ 10 min.
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 6
Add 200 g cream, season with salt and pepper and bring to the boil.

Then lower the heat and allow to thicken gently.

Check seasoning.

Stage 7 - ⌛ 7 min.
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 7
Meanwhile, cook 400 g Pasta, then drain.

Stage 8 - ⌛ 2 min.
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 8
Return the pasta to the pan, add the beans and pour over the creamy bacon sauce.

Return to the heat for 1 or 2 minutes, stirring well.

Stage 9
Country-style spring pasta : Stage 9
Your pasta is ready.
Remarks
If you don't have sage, replace it with a bay leaf or a few sprigs of thyme.

If you prefer, you can remove the sage in step 8.
Keeping: 1 or 2 days in the fridge, protected by cling film.
